Local knowledge isn’t something I learned from a map.
Long before real estate became my career, I was involved in the conversations shaping the communities I now help buyers, sellers, military families and investors navigate.
I spent eight years serving on the King George County Board of Supervisors, including serving as the first woman selected to chair the Board. My work expanded well beyond county lines through regional, statewide and national leadership involving economic development, rural broadband, military and veteran issues, workforce development, the Chesapeake Bay watershed and local government.
That experience still shapes the way I approach real estate today.
I pay attention to infrastructure. I watch development. I ask questions about how communities are changing, where investment is happening and what may matter to a property owner years from now—not simply on closing day.

Virginia Association of Counties | NACo Executive Committee
In 2017, I was elected to the National Association of Counties Executive Committee as the South Region Representative, representing a region spanning 12 states.
The feature also highlights my work with NACo’s Veterans and Military Services Committee, Rural Action Caucus and Agricultural and Rural Affairs Committee.
